A woman was injured in a Russian attack on Vinnytsia Oblast on the night of 25-26 February, which damaged energy facilities and nearly 40 residential buildings.

Source: Nataliia Zabolotna, Head of Vinnytsia Oblast Military Administration

Quote: "There were five cruise missiles and 18 UAVs in the oblast's airspace.

Sadly, as a result of this attack, nearly 40 houses have been damaged and sustained significant destruction."

Details: A woman was injured; she is now receiving the necessary assistance.

Zabolotna said that energy facilities were damaged, but the attack did not cause power cuts in the oblast.

She added that scheduled outages are applied at a level of two and a half queues. [A "queue" is a group of consumers and businesses using a specific amount of megawatts. The Dispatch Centre sets the number of queues needed across oblasts to address energy deficit – ed.]

Background:

  • Russia launched an attack on the night of 25-26 February using two Tsirkon (Zircon) anti-ship missiles, ballistic missiles, air-launched missiles and strike drones. Ukrainian air defence downed 406 out of 459 Russian aerial assets.
  • Five ballistic missiles and 46 strike UAVs hit targets at 32 locations. Debris from downed targets fell at 15 locations.
